Computer Problems I was on my computer last night and everything was fine. I got up this morning and tried to turn it on ..... nothing. The cord is fine and the jack is fine. Had them tested today. The tech seemed to think there is a short in the power button. But can only tell if I leave it with them for a diagnosis charge. My computer is 4 years old. So, don't know if it is really worth the expense of getting it fixed. :( Has anyone ever had anything similar happen and if so what was the problem? Ever heard of a short in the power button? |
I am not sure what kind of computer you have but it could be your power supply box inside your computer. Mine at home went out, and so did mine at work so I think it is fairly common. Both are about the same age as yours. Once I had that replaced, I didn't have any other problems. Good luck! |

Is this a desktop or a laptop? My experiences are desktops. To replace my power supply was under 100 each time it happened. They should be able to tell when trying to power on your computer if it is the power supply. It makes noises like it's trying to power on but nothing really ever happens, like it's trying but there's just not enough power to run it. I've never had a falty on/off switch. |
